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ix SRT_REG081 - Cannot determine variant &1 for virtual interface &2


SAP Error Message - Details

  • Message type: E = Error

  • Message class: SRT_REG - SRT Registry

  • Message number: 081

  • Message text: Cannot determine variant &1 for virtual interface &2

  • Show details Hide details
  • What causes this issue?

    An attempt was made to find the corresponding (internal) variant for the
    virtual interface "&V2&". "&V1&" was used as input for the (external)
    name of the variant.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Change your input to specify a valid combination of service definition
    and variant.
    Use the search help to get values for the input fields. Choosing a
    service definition restricts the variants that you can choose from.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message SRT_REG081 - Cannot determine variant &1 for virtual interface &2 ?

    The SAP error message SRT_REG081 indicates that the system is unable to determine a specific variant for a virtual interface. This typically occurs in the context of SAP Process Integration (PI) or SAP Process Orchestration (PO) when dealing with web services or service-oriented architecture (SOA) scenarios.

    Cause:

    The error can be caused by several factors, including:

    1. Missing or Incorrect Configuration: The variant specified for the virtual interface may not be defined or may be incorrectly configured in the system.
    2. Transport Issues: If the configuration was recently transported from one system to another (e.g., from development to production), the variant may not have been included in the transport.
    3. Authorization Issues: The user or service may not have the necessary authorizations to access the specified variant.
    4. System Errors: There may be underlying system issues or inconsistencies in the configuration.

    Solution:

    To resolve the error, you can take the following steps:

    1. Check Configuration:

      • Go to the relevant configuration in the SAP system (e.g., SOA Manager or Integration Builder).
      • Verify that the variant for the virtual interface is correctly defined and active.
    2. Review Transport Requests:

      • If the issue arose after a transport, check the transport request to ensure that all necessary objects, including the variant, were included and successfully imported.
    3. Check Authorizations:

      • Ensure that the user or service account has the necessary authorizations to access the virtual interface and its variants.
    4. Recreate the Variant:

      • If the variant is missing or corrupted, consider recreating it in the system.
    5. Check Logs:

      • Review the application logs (transaction SLG1) and the system logs (transaction SM21) for any additional error messages or warnings that could provide more context.
    6. Consult Documentation:

      • Refer to SAP documentation or notes related to the specific version of SAP you are using for any known issues or additional troubleshooting steps.
    7. Contact SAP Support:

      • If the issue persists after trying the above steps, consider reaching out to SAP support for further assistance.

    Related Information:

    • Transaction Codes:

      • SOAMANAGER: For managing web service configurations.
      • SICF: For checking and managing HTTP services.
      • SLG1: For viewing application logs.
      • SM21: For checking system logs.
    • SAP Notes: Search for relevant SAP Notes in the SAP Support Portal that may address this specific error or provide additional troubleshooting steps.

    • Documentation: Review the SAP Help Portal for documentation on configuring virtual interfaces and variants in SAP PI/PO.

    By following these steps, you should be able to identify and resolve the cause of the SRT_REG081 error in your SAP system.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ker